Transaction 33ada932585346fa3f4b762ceff454afc1672dc4d0dba8477b29de9e8454b86e
1 Input
1 Output
-
33ada932585346fa3f4b762ceff454afc1672dc4d0dba8477b29de9e8454b86e:0
- value
- 565215
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 303a7938195d7774e350dffbbc84a0f7b764a581 OP_EQUAL
- address
- 3662QZaQYSZfkh38Nzt8x2g9tJwjqxQeW6